Cuba weather in September

The riskiest month — peak of hurricane season and the wettest weather. Only with flexibility and insurance.

September is the statistical peak of the Atlantic hurricane season and Cuba's wettest month. It's the cheapest, quietest time, but the storm risk is real — travel only with flexible bookings, travel medical insurance and a close eye on the forecast.

How September compares

Cuba's most reliable weather is the dry season, roughly November to April — driest and sunniest around January, February, March, April, December. The wet season (May–October) is hotter and greener with cheaper prices, and overlaps the Atlantic hurricane season (1 June–30 November, peak September).

How hot is Cuba in September?
In September, daytime highs typically reach about 31°C (88°F) and nights fall to around 24°C (75°F). The sea sits near 29°C (84°F). These are typical monthly averages — check the live conditions above for what it is doing right now.
Does it rain in Cuba in September?
September is in Cuba's wet season, with very high rainfall — wettest — heavy afternoon rain, roughly 13 days with some rain. Rain usually comes as short, heavy afternoon downpours that clear quickly, with sunny mornings.
Is September in Cuba's hurricane season?
Yes. The Atlantic hurricane season runs 1 June to 30 November and September's risk is at its statistical peak. Most days are unaffected, but travel with flexible bookings, travel medical insurance, and watch the live NHC storm map on our weather page.
What should I pack for Cuba in September?
Light, breathable clothing, sun protection and a hat year-round; a compact rain jacket or umbrella for afternoon showers; and swimwear — the sea is a warm 29°C (84°F).
